Why are hourly rates better than fixed rates?

When it comes to cleaning services, there are two main pricing models: hourly cleaning and fixed-priced cleaning. While both have their pros and cons, hourly cleaning offers a number of benefits that make it the preferred choice for many people. Here are ten points to consider when making your decision. Customization One of the biggest advantages of hourly cleaning is that you can customize the service to meet your specific needs. If you have a particularly dirty area that needs extra attention, the cleaner can spend more time on it without worrying about going over the set time limit. On the other hand, if you only need a quick tidy-up, the cleaner can focus on the essentials and get in and out in a timely manner.   Flexibility Hourly cleaning is also much more flexible than fixed-priced cleaning. If you have a last-minute change of plans, you can easily reschedule or cancel the cleaning service without worrying about losing money. With fixed-priced cleaning, you are usually required to pay a set fee, regardless of whether you use the service or not. Better Value for Money Hourly cleaning can also offer better value for money, as you only pay for the time spent cleaning. This means that you can get the same level of cleaning done in less time, saving you money in the long run. With fixed-priced cleaning, you often end up paying for the time that is not actually spent cleaning, as the cleaner may need to take breaks or run errands. More Efficient Cleaning When cleaners are paid hourly, they are motivated to work efficiently and get the job done in a timely manner. This means that you can expect a higher level of productivity, with the cleaner getting more done in less time. With fixed-priced cleaning, the cleaner may not feel the same sense of urgency and may take their time, leading to a less efficient cleaning experience. Ability to Monitor Progress When cleaners are paid hourly, you can easily monitor their progress and ensure that they are meeting your expectations. If you notice that the cleaner is not working effectively, you can address the issue in real-time, allowing for a quicker resolution. With fixed-priced cleaning, it can be difficult to know if the cleaner is doing a good job or not, as they are not usually on site for the entire cleaning process. Better Control Over Costs Hourly cleaning gives you better control over your cleaning costs, as you can easily keep track of the time spent cleaning and adjust your budget accordingly. With fixed-priced cleaning, you may end up paying more than you anticipated, as the cleaning service may take longer than expected or you may need additional services that are not included in the fixed fee. Greater Attention to Detail Cleaners who are paid hourly are more likely to pay attention to the details, as they want to make the most of their time and ensure that they are providing a high-quality service. With fixed-priced cleaning, the cleaner may be more focused on getting the job done quickly, rather than ensuring that every corner is spotless. Increased Trust and Communication When cleaners are paid hourly, there is often a greater level of trust and communication between the cleaner and the client. The cleaner is more likely to be open and honest about the time required to complete the job, allowing you to make an informed decision about whether to proceed. With fixed-priced cleaning, the cleaner may be more likely to cut corners or rush the job in order to meet the set time limit.

COVID-Safe Kit

When the World Health Organization officially declared a global pandemic, the public’s expectations of cleanliness drastically changed. It is safe to say that majority, if not all, had stopped cleaning just for appearance. This change also challenged the cleaning industry and called for them to implement new and better cleaning protocols. This was also true for Beckii and The Clean Life. The onset of the pandemic challenged Beckii to think up different ways to ensure the safety of The Clean Life’s clients while improving the standard of cleanliness that they provide to clients’ homes.  One of the ways that Beckii has come up with is the implementation of the COVID-Safe Kit. The COVID-Safe Kit is a cleaning kit containing reusable items that the cleaners use to clean their client’s homes. It contains: 2 grouters; 1 scrubbing brush; 1 squeegee; 9 microfibre cloths; and 1 commercial grade mop head       The COVID-Safe Kit is a unique initiative by Beckii and is the first of its kind in domestic cleaning. The purpose of the kit is mainly to reduce cross-contamination between homes from reusable cleaning equipment. All of the items in the kit are tools that are used to clean the dirtiest parts of a home and have the highest chances of carrying with them germs and bacteria. By keeping these items in the clients’ respective homes, it fully prevents cross-contamination and lessens the risk of cleaners bringing in foreign germs and bacteria from one home to another. The COVID-Safe kits are available for purchase in The Clean Life’s online store for non-clients and are available to clients on their first clean! The clients are given the choice of either purchasing each of the items in the kit by themselves or availing of the COVID-Safe Kit on their first cleaning appointment. The Clean Life: About Hourly Rates

WHAT IS AN HOURLY RATE? At The Clean Life, no matter what type of clean you book, we charge an hourly rate. An HOURLY RATE means that you are charged based on the amount of time that our cleaners stay in your home to finish all the tasks that you require. WHY AN HOURLY RATE? An hourly rate is a fair system, for the client, the cleaners and the company. If you are away, but your home just needs a dust, your home will require less work, so we will charge accordingly. If the cleaners need to leave early for whatever reason, you will only be charged the time spent at your home. If your home is more built up, or if it requires a bit more of a deeper clean, we have flexibility to complete the whole job to the expected quality level, without having to rush, or miss things. No matter what the situation – you only pay the cleaners based on the amount of work completed.  OUR PROCESS Due to the flexibility of hourly rates, clients often express worry about how open-ended and varied it is. The Clean Life understands this and has ensured there are multiple safeguards in place to protect clients. The Clean Life also ensures that there is sufficient communication and transparency with the clients especially regarding costs and any issues regarding payments are answered with 100% honesty. Initial Deep Clean Estimate When clients first reach out to us, we ask a series of questions to ascertain size, currrent condition, and requirements of your home. We will then give an estimate based on the photos and description you have given of your home. We will book this estimated period of time, and if longer is required, we will communicate and request permission. Regular Cleaning Estimate After the initial deep clean of a home has been completed, the cleaners will estimate the amount of time it will take regularly to keep your home up to maintenance standard (which is usually less than the initial deep clean estimate). This new estimate is communicated to admin staff, and will become the basis for ongoing cleaning. 15-minute allowance (for regular cleaning ONLY)  The cleaners are expected to follow the ongoing cleaning estimate, however, they require flexibility, as from week to week, your home may need more or less cleaning. This hourly rate keeps things fair and reasonable, and within an expected 30 min time frame/budget. (15 min under, or over.) The admins will reach out to you if the cleaners need more than 15 minutes, past the estimate to finish everything. For eg – if your home has been set at 1 hour 15 mins, we would allow the cleaners anywhere between 1 hours -1 hours 30 mins to finish your home. Anything over that would require your permission. Capped Cleans (NOT recommended)  If you are working on a budget, we may allow for capped cleans i.e. cleans that are based on a strict time frame (and budget) rather than the amount of work needing to be done. When we cap a clean at a certain price, it means that we may not get all areas of your house completed, or have to rush over some areas. It leaves us dissatisfied – as we like to have the time to do a really good job and finish the home. We will not promise more than we can deliver (in a reduced time frame), whilst still trying to keep the standard of cleaning high. Our aim is to always achieve an excellent result – but in our experience,  when we cap an amount, it makes it hard to really show you what can be achieved when your whole home is done to our usual standard. Expectations are really important in this kind of clean – if you really do have your heart set on just doing a few items  – lets discuss your priorities and what can be reasonably expected during the time we have.
